    CHEP accredited as a 2023 Global Top Employer

    CHEP, a leader in supply chain solutions, has been recognised as a Global Top Employer for 2023 by Top Employers Institute, a global certifier recognising excellence in employee conditions.

    Receiving global accreditation for the first time, CHEP, as part of the Brambles Group, was among only 15 Global Top Employers in 2023 to be recognised for outstanding HR policies and practices worldwide. CHEP and Brambles have also expanded the number of regions and countries where they are accredited, earning the Top Employer seal in Asia Pacific for the first time while retaining Top Employer status in Europe, Latin America and Africa, along with 25 countries across every region.

    Patrick Bradley, Brambles Chief People Officer, said: “Becoming a Global Top Employer in 2023 is a great moment of pride for CHEP. It recognises the ongoing efforts we have made to build a safe, inclusive and respectful workplace that offers employees a purposeful and fulfilling experience. We continue to take strides towards our “Workplace Positive” goals as part of our 2025 Sustainability Strategy, to deliver a truly inclusive environment that fosters innovation, growth and agility.”

    The Top Employers Institute programme certifies organisations based on the participation and results of their HR Best Practices Survey. This survey covers six HR domains consisting of 20 topics.

    Among the categories where CHEP excelled against peers were People Strategy, Leadership, Diversity & Inclusion and Sustainability.

    In 2022, CHEP achieved 33% of women in management roles globally and reached 40% female representation on its Board. Following an increased focus on employee health, safety and wellbeing, the company recorded an 18% improvement in its Brambles Injury Frequency Rate (BIFR) performance, reflecting targeted efforts to reach Zero Harm across its global operations. Top Employers Institute CEO, David Plink, said: “Exceptional times bring out the best in people and organisations. And we have witnessed this in our Top Employers Certification Programme this year: an exceptional performance from the certified Top Employers 2023. Amongst this community of outstanding organisations, CHEP has proven its commitment to employees on a global scale. This consistency in people practices across the globe characterises an exclusive group of companies that have achieved a global certification through the Top Employers Programme. We are proud to announce and celebrate these companies and their achievement in 2023.”
